I am pretty experienced, I've been incubator for a good while. I know what I'm looking at and I don't candle everyday. I was supposed to candle yesterday anyway (day 10), but didn't because I didn't want to open the incubator while it was off. At this point, if they're alive still, they'll be bouncing around in their eggs. I think they'll be fine. The temp dipped down into the 80s, which isn't too bad, but isn't great either. When I noticed the power was out, I covered the bator with a blanket and cranked up the wood stove, which managed to keep everything pretty warm.
